LOS ANGELES--(BUSINESS WIRE)--Hope Bancorp, Inc. (NASDAQ: HOPE) today announced that the Company will report financial results for its second quarter and six months ended June 30, 2025, before the markets open on Tuesday, July 22, 2025.
A conference call to discuss 2025 second quarter financial results will be held on Tuesday, July 22, 2025, at 9:30 a.m. Pacific Time / 12:30 p.m. Eastern Time. A presentation deck to accompany the earnings call will be available at Hope Bancorp's investor relations website, www.ir-hopebancorp.com.

About Hope Bancorp, Inc.
Hope Bancorp, Inc. (NASDAQ: HOPE) is the holding company of Bank of Hope, the only regional Korean American bank in the United States with $17.07 billion in total assets as of March 31, 2025. With the addition of Territorial Savings, a division of Bank of Hope, effective April 2, 2025, the Company became the largest regional bank catering to multicultural customers across the continental United States and Hawaii. Headquartered in Los Angeles, the Bank provides a full suite of commercial, corporate and consumer loans, deposit and fee-based products and services, including commercial and commercial real estate lending, SBA lending, residential mortgage and other consumer lending; treasury management services, foreign currency exchange solutions, interest rate derivative products, and international trade financing, among others. The Bank operates 46 full-service branches in California, New York, New Jersey, Washington, Texas, Illinois, New York, New Jersey, Alabama and Georgia under the Bank of Hope banner, and 29 branches in Hawaii under the Territorial Savings banner. The Bank also operates SBA loan production offices, commercial loan production offices, and residential mortgage loan production offices throughout the United States, and a representative office in Seoul, South Korea. Bank of Hope is a California-chartered bank, and its deposits are insured by the FDIC to the extent provided by law. Bank of Hope is an Equal Opportunity Lender. President Donald Trump said he plans to set new tariffs on semiconductors in the coming weeks, intensifying his push to reshape global supply chains. Speaking aboard Air Force One, Trump stated he would implement levies next week and the week after targeting steel and possibly semiconductors. While he already raised steel duties to 50% in June, the mention of chips marks a potential escalation in his trade strategy, especially as the Commerce Department continues national security investigations into the semiconductor and pharmaceutical sectors. Warning! GuruFocus has detected 5 Warning Sign with UNH. Trump had earlier floated a 100% tariff on imported semiconductors, with possible exemptions for companies relocating manufacturing to the U.S. During a meeting last week with Apple (NASDAQ:AAPL) CEO Tim Cook, Trump hinted Apple could qualify for an exemption given its pledged $600 billion investment in domestic production. However, he offered no specifics on how those carve-outs would be structured. On Friday, he went further, suggesting duties could rise to 200%, 300%, adding uncertainty for chipmakers and artificial intelligence firms dependent on international supply chains. The president also linked his tariff plans to geopolitical discussions, suggesting the topic could surface during his summit with Russian President Vladimir Putin. Trump noted that Russian business leaders would be attending the meeting but indicated that deeper trade cooperation would depend on progress toward ending the war in Ukraine. Meanwhile, Trump has continued threatening tariffs elsewhere, including a 50% levy on Indian goods and potential increases on Russian energy imports if talks stall. Investors watching the semiconductor space, including firms like Tesla (NASDAQ:TSLA) and Apple, are likely weighing how such moves could ripple through production costs and global sourcing strategies.
